Maya Was Grumpy by Courtney Pippin-Mathur: “Maya was grumpy. She didn’t know why she was grumpy. She was just in a crispy, cranky, grumpy, grouchy mood. She didn’t want to read or color or eat banana slices or wear her favorite shorts or go outside and play. So she GRUMPED, GLUMPED, CLUMPED, and THUMPED around the house. Can Grandma’s patience and humor coax Maya out of her bad mood?” (May 2013)

Words in Question by Cathy DeLuca: “Words in Question is filled with quizzes to challenge your thinking in a variety of fun puzzles and questions about words. From daffy definitions to homophones and palindromes, you will find lots of ways in this book to challenge your knowledge of words and rev up your brain cells!” (August 2013)
